The Au-Pair program is a cultural exchange where the candidate stays for at least a few months with a family in a foreign country. The family provides the candidate with a private room and regular meals. In exchange for that, the Au-Pair helps with childcare and light household chores.

What is the Au Pair program? The Au Pair program is an international cultural exchange that gives the possibility to young people to spend some time abroad, learn more about a different culture, improve their skills in a foreign language in exchange for help with duties related to childcare. In terms of cost, Au Pair International charges roughly $7,700 in program fees (not including the mandatory weekly stipend paid to your au pair). That fee also doesn’t include international travel or car insurance, so by the time you fill in the gaps, the price is comparable to other agencies.

There are two types of Au pair placement programs: agencies that screen and match clients and websites that allow you to create a personal profile and search for families independently. And of course, you don’t have to choose just one or the other, you can be on both.

The number of hours the Au Pair works each week is determined by the Host Family and cannot exceed regulation maximums. EduCare Au Pairs work a maximum of 30 hours per week.

The au pair is considered as a full member of the family during the temporary period of the au pair stay. As such, he or she helps the family with childcare and can be asked to assume some light household tasks.In return, the host family provides free board and lodging, as well as pocket money.However, the au pair is neither a housekeeper, nor a nanny. Au pairs travel to the U.S. on a legal J-1 visa, allowing them to stay in the country (and with your family) for up to two years with the extension program. Support Au pair screening, training,

This brings the program fees to about $7,800, which includes the standard background check, psychometric screening, visa application, airfare, childcare training, and local support. Au pairs stay with host families chosen by sponsoring organizations, and are provided a private bedroom, meals, a full weekend off each month, two weeks paid vacation, up to $500 toward attending an institution of higher education, and a cash stipend tied to the U.S. minimum wage. In the U.S., the au pair program is a J-1 visa exchange visitor program regulated by the U.S. Department of State —and a cultural exchange program at heart.
